Fair Trade in Tourism South Africa (FTTSA) is a non-profit organisation that promotes sustainable tourism development.

We do this through awareness raising, research and advocacy, capacity building and by facilitating the world’s first tourism Fair Trade certification programme.

FTTSA awards the use of special label to qualifying businesses as a way of signifying their commitment to Fair Trade criteria including fair wages and working conditions, fair purchasing, fair operations, equitable distribution of benefits and respect for human rights, culture and environment.

By electing to stay at or use the services of an FTTSA-certified establishment, tourists are assured that their travel benefits local communities and economies, and that the business is operated ethically and in a socially and environmentally responsible manner.

Responsible Action

Fair Trade in Tourism South Africa (FTTSA) encourages and publicises fair and responsible business practice by South African tourism establishments. We do this by offering a certification programme (and supporting activities) that endorses tourism establishments that meet stringent criteria.

Fair wages and working conditions, fair operations, purchasing and distribution of benefits
Ethical business practice
Respect for human rights, culture and the environment

Our Vision
FTTSA's vision is for a fair, participatory and sustainable tourism industry in South Africa

Our Mission
FTTSA's mission is to facilitate the integration of Fair Trade in Tourism principles and criteria into South African tourism so that the industry is more sustainable.

Part of FTTSA’s mission is to create the conditions for more successful community-owned and operated tourism throughout South Africa. Linked to this, we facilitate a number of projects designed to directly and indirectly assist existing community-based tourism enterprises to become commercially successful.
